Hi,

I recently bought a Smoothieboard x5, and I am trying to connect and run my motor through the TB6560 Stepper motor driver, but I am having no luck.
I have been able to run the motors through the internal drivers on the Smoothieboard, but with my motors being 3.5amps I need to be able to run via the external drivers in order to gain extra torque.

So far I have wired the motors as in attached image.

That is 5v to 5v (I've set alpha_step_pin  2.0o) all other pins appear to be connected correctly.

When I attempt to run the motors the run LED comes on, on the Stepper driver (TB6560) but the motors do not turn or make any noise at all. This tells me it is getting some sort of signal.

Is there any config settings that need to change, or have I got the wiring correct?

Also, what would be the correct Dip pin settings for this?

On Mon, Oct 23, 2017 at 9:03 PM, Aidan gleeson <aidangl...@gmail.com> wrote:
Hi Mark,
 
Thanks for the reply, but my driver only has positive Step, Dir, En and 5V inputs, it does not have the negative Step, -Dir or - En pins. Is my driver even compatible with the Smoothie? 

Of course.

You just have a shared GND connection instead of a GND connection for each signal.
Means your driver isn't as good for noise protection, but it should still work, and it's definitely compatible with Smoothie.

See this image for example for how it's supposed to be wired : https://cdn.instructables.com/F0U/D53T/IO34DJI8/F0UD53TIO34DJI8.LARGE.jpg

If you look at http://smoothieware.org/cnc-mill-guide#external-stepper-drivers it has two methods ( shared GND or shared 5V ) and you want the first one, as that's the only one your driver allows ( so no open-drain ).

I think your connections are correct and that particular board needs a common 5V supply and also needs the step, direction and enable to be open drain.
Our experience with similar low cost TB6560 and TB6660 boards has not been good when working with the Smoothie board. We have had problems in both common +5 and common ground configurations. The boards and modules we used had different component values on different batches, some would work and some not. The Optocouplers seem to be of poor quality, so they pull a lot of current through the LED, which is a problem for the Smoothie board driver. They also seem to use the step pulse to trigger internal current control which makes the step pulse very critical.
We tried lots of fixes by changing components and increasing the length of the step pulse, but we still got intermittent results when driving direct from the Smoothieboard
Our fix was to use external ULQ2003 darlington drivers for the step, direction and enable.
We already had a board we had developed from the smoothie on a breadboard to drive our CNC Mill which needed 12V drive for the steppers. When we swapped the Smoothie with this board which has a strong 5V drive, all our problems disappeared.
